HomeMy Public PortalAboutOrd. 0223ORDINANCE Nr.z2 AN ORDINANCE O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F LYNWOOD REGULATING SUPERVISION OF PUBLIC DANCES IN THE CITY OF LYNWOOD. The City Council of the City of Lynwood do ordain as follows: SECTION I: It shall be unlawful for any person, firm or corporation to conduct or maintain any public dance hall, dancing club or place where public dancing is provided for, with- out having first obtained a permit and license therefor. SECTION I1 : Application for such permit shall be made to the City Council, and the Council hereby reserves the right to reject such application should it, after such investiga- tion as it may deem sufficient, determine that such permit, or the conduct of business thereunder, would be detrimental to the public welfare. SECTION III Should such permit be granted, then the License Clerk shall issue a license thereunder, which shall be re- vocable by the City Council at any time thereafter, should it, after such investigation as it msy deem sufficient, determine that the same, or the conduct of the business thereunder, has become detrimental to the public welfare. SECTION IV: The fee for such license shall be the sum of $25.00 per annum, payable annually in advance, and in addition to such license fee, such licensee shall, on the first day of each week, deposit with the License Clerk the sum of $1.00 for each hour during the previous week in which any dancing has been conducted under such license, such deposit being for the payment of the costs of such special supervision as the Chief of Police may deem advisable. The Chief of Police is hereby authorized to waive any of the said weekly deposits of any licensee should he determine that no special supervision is necessary as to such licensee. -1- SECTION V: Ary person, firm or corporation con- ducting or maintaining any public dance hall, dancing club or place where public dancing is provided for, without having a valid license therefor, shall be deemed guilty of a misdemeanor, and upon conviction therefor shall be punishable by a fine not exceeding $300.00 or by imprisonment for a period not exceeding three months, or by both such fine and imprisonment. SECTION V I: The City Clerk shall certify to the passage of this ordinance and cause the same to be published once in the Lynwood Press and the same shall become effective thirty days from the passage thereof.
